Details for Kilocalorie per Hour (Thermochemical)
Introduction : This unit reflects power using the thermochemical definition of kilocalorie (1 kcal(th) = 4.184 kJ), making it useful in chemically accurate thermal systems. It’s widely applied in labs and scientific studies.
History & Origin : Defined to ensure uniformity in thermochemical experiments, this unit differs slightly from IT values, making it better suited for exact calorimetric and combustion-based measurements.
Current Use : Used in laboratory calorimetry, bioenergetics, and food energy analysis. Suitable for chemical engineering applications where precision in thermal output is critical for process safety and efficiency.
